I should like to point out that it's not the act of not doing a practise PAN that I'm against (although as pointed out it's always useful to try something before you have to use it in anger) it's the notion that the 2 posters in question seem to suggest that they've never had it even explained to them. I should also point out as an ex D&D controller who has spoken on the phone (post-incident)both to students who'd done practises with us before using us for real and to students who'd only be talked through it on the ground, the evidence seems to suggest that to practise first with an instructor is best practise. A number of the people who call do so as a last resort, some have been in tears and have got to the stage where they even need to be talked through how to fly the ac. There are a number of tales that would require a mighty large sandbag to be pulled up, but suffice to say that practise makes perfect.

And LH2 sorry, but D&D was originally given DF on VHF by the CAA as a means of reducing CAS infringements - the idea being that GA would have someone to turn to to help them out. This is also the reason why Farnborough have introduced London LARS - to ensure that a LARS is available around the TMA to try to reduce CAS infringements.
